Phone number ☎️ 01452201281 👆 is reported as a persistent and intrusive nuisance, often calling early in the morning with no clear purpose or identified organisation. Callers frequently claim to be from "UK Essentials," display foreign accents, and ask for personal information while refusing to disclose their identity. Many recipients experience silent responses, hang-ups, or abrupt disconnections when questioned. The number is widely suspected to be linked to scam or phishing attempts, with callers becoming rude or aggressive if challenged. Despite registration with the Telephone Preference Service, calls continue unabated. Users strongly advise against answering or providing any personal details, recommending immediate blocking to avoid further harassment.

About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by homes and businesses.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during certain times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with many pl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
